Ulster is one of the four traditional provinces of Ireland, located in the northern part of the island. It consists of nine counties, six of which are in Northern Ireland and three in the Republic of Ireland. Ulster has a rich cultural and historical significance, with a diverse population and a strong sense of identity.

Geography and Landscape

Ulster is known for its stunning landscapes, including rugged coastline, mountains, and rolling hills. The province is home to iconic landmarks such as the Giant's Causeway, Slieve League cliffs, and the Mourne Mountains. The diverse geography of Ulster makes it a popular destination for outdoor enthusiasts and nature lovers.

Economy and Industry

Ulster has a diverse economy, with industries ranging from agriculture and manufacturing to technology and tourism. Major cities such as Belfast and Derry/Londonderry are hubs for business and commerce, while rural areas are known for their farming and fishing communities. The province has seen significant growth in recent years, attracting investment and creating jobs for its residents.
